- Brief Summary
This was a single-centre, single-arm, non-blinded, prospective study using 20 patients with advanced metastatic GI malignancies recruited to treat patients with advanced metastatic GI malignancies with 177Lu-CTR-FAPI to assess the safety of 177Lu-CTR-FAPI in advanced metastatic GI malignancies; this included radiation therapy dosimetry and initial treatment Determination of Effectiveness

-
- voluntary participation in this study and signing of informed consent;
-
- age 18-75 years (both 18 and 75 years);
-
- ECOG (Eastern Cooperative Oncology Group) physical status score: 0-1;
- 4.Advanced metastatic gastrointestinal malignancies with high FAP expression: e.g. neuroendocrine tumours (NET G2, G3), neuroendocrine carcinomas (NEC), pancreatic ductal adenocarcinomas (PDAC), gastric adenocarcinomas, colorectal carcinomas, intrahepatic cholangiocarcinomas (ICC), and squamous carcinomas of the oesophagus. All of the above should be confirmed by 68Ga-FAPI PET/CT with high FAP expression (criterion: more than 50% of lesions with SUVmax ≥10). 5.
-
- Disease status: locally advanced unresectable or metastatic lesions confirmed by imaging (CT/MRI/PET-CT); at least 1 measurable lesion (RECIST 1.1 criteria).

Disease-related:
-
Combination of other malignancies (except non-melanoma skin cancer or radical tumours without recurrence within 5 years);
-
Presence of central nervous system metastases or carcinomatous meningitis;
-
Uncontrolled cancer pain (requiring long-term high-dose opioids) or cachexia (≥20% weight loss in 6 months);
-
Diabetes mellitus (fasting blood glucose > 2 x ULN) that is not well controlled with optimal medical supportive therapy;
-
Accompanied by poorly controlled plasmapheresis, including pleural fluid, ascites, and pericardial effusion; controlled with treatment and stable (asymptomatic, not requiring interventional therapy, and stable on imaging) for ≥2 weeks may be included;
-
Severe urinary incontinence, hydronephrosis, severe voiding dysfunction or the need for an indwelling urinary catheter for any reason;
-
Subjects with uncontrolled cardiac clinical symptoms or disease, including but not limited to: i) NYHA class 2 or higher heart failure; ii) unstable angina; iii) myocardial infarction within 1 year prior to enrolment; iv) left ventricular ejection fraction (LVEF) <50%; v) clinically significant supraventricular or ventricular arrhythmias requiring treatment or intervention;
-
Co-occurring active hepatitis B (HBV-DNA testing is required for HBsAg-positive individuals with HBV DNA ≥500 IU/mL or 2500 copies/mL), and hepatitis C (HCV-Ab-positive and above the lower limit of detection of the analytical method);
-
Persons known to have acquired immunodeficiency syndrome (AIDS) or human immunodeficiency virus (HIV) testing positive. Persons with active syphilis infection.

Treatment related
-
Radiotherapy within 4 weeks or previous radiotherapy to >25% of the bone marrow area;
-
Received systemic anti-tumour therapy such as chemotherapy, immunotherapy, targeted therapy within 4 weeks;
-
Treatment with surgery (biopsy puncture, non-anti-tumour surgical operations such as ERCP may be excluded), radiofrequency ablation or cryoablation, interferon, transcatheter arterial embolisation (TAE) or transcatheter arterial chemoembolisation (TACE) within 12 weeks;
-
Prior FAP-targeted therapy (e.g., FAPI-PRRT, anti-FAP antibody drugs);
-
Presence of contraindications to radionuclide therapy (e.g., myelodysplastic syndrome, extensive bone metastases with bone marrow failure).
